Что это значит?
This verse tells us that Onan displeased God by not following His command to raise up offspring for his deceased brother. God was so displeased that He caused Onan's death. This is a direct statement from the Bible, showing the seriousness of disobedience.

Исторический контекст
Genesis was written by Moses around 1446-1406 BC. It was aimed at the Israelites to remind them of their origins and God’s covenant with them. In the cultural setting, raising up offspring for a deceased brother was a significant duty.
